Freeze-thaw cycles and drainage needs in Glenmont mean you should prioritize materials that compact well and shed water in freeze conditions, especially for driveways and base layers. For areas with poor drainage, choose coarser, well-draining mixes to reduce frost heave risks, and use finer top layers where a smooth finish is needed. Permit and zoning rules vary by town and neighborhood in the Glenmont area, so always check with your local building department or homeowners association before starting driveway or major grading work. Large deliveries may also require driveway access checks or street permits in some locations. If you need help, our team can remind you to verify permits as part of project planning.
Base your choice on the project's purpose: load-bearing surfaces need materials that compact and support weight, while planting beds need materials that promote drainage and root growth. Consider desired appearance, maintenance level, and budget when comparing gravel, sand, dirt, stone as groups. A simple rule of thumb is to use our material calculator, but as a rough guide many materials cover about 40 to 60 square feet at a 2-inch depth per ton, with variation by material density and type. For base layers or heavy-duty work, required depth will be greater, so quantities increase accordingly. If you share project dimensions, our sales team can help verify your estimate.
